astro wants to migrate every subscriber to byond may be because they want to convert all channels to mpeg4 format, old decoder can only decode mpeg2 video

astro max users were allowed to upgrade to byond PVR free of charge and without adding extra RM20 HD service

old CRT tv can be connected to byond's composite video output

QUOTE(RAMChYLD @ Jan 31 2012, 02:42 PM)
Assteruk is really greedy and/or stupid. Should make the decoder work with any hard disk, not just WD Passport AV...
*
The reason is because those wd av hdd do not have error correction. Essential for CCTV and recording. Normal hard disks have error correction that will verify data integrity upon writing. Can't have such function when you are recording live feed
